Approximately 66 million years ago, a significant geological event known as the Cretaceous-Paleogene (K-Pg) extinction event occurred. This event is famously associated with the impact of a large asteroid or comet near present-day Yucatán Peninsula, Mexico, leading to drastic environmental changes. It resulted in the extinction of about 75% of Earth's species, including the non-avian dinosaurs, and dramatically reshaped the planet's biodiversity and ecosystems.

What does Ma mean in geology?

Ma means million years or million years ago. So and event that ocurred at 60 Ma ocurred 60 million years ago.

How many millions of years ago did dinosaurs become extinct?

The Cretaceous-Tertiary extinction event, is the name given to the die-off of the dinosaurs and other species that took place some 65.5 million years ago. For many years, paleontologists believed this event was caused by climate and geological changes that interrupted the dinosaurs' food supply.

Which dinosaur is older the proceratops or the triceratops?

Protoceratops is older, having existed between 75 and 71 million years ago. Triceratops existed at the very end of the Mesozoic, from 68 million years ago to the extinction event 65.5 million years ago.
